My film is "Marion Stoddart: The Work of 1000". It's a short documentary that tells the story of an adventurous, young "ordinary" woman, caught in the seemingly dull life of a suburban housewife in the 1960s. But, she found her passion, and took on big business, politicians, and a skeptical public to save a dying river, which also saved her!
